Step-by-Step Guide to Creating a Funeral Program – Helpful Guide & Resources

Introduction

Losing a loved one is never easy, and planning a funeral can be overwhelming. One important aspect of a funeral service is the funeral program. Creating a funeral program can be a meaningful way to honor the memory of the deceased and provide comfort to those attending the service. In this step-by-step guide, we will walk you through the process of creating a personalized and heartfelt funeral program.

1. Gather Information

Start by gathering important information about the deceased, such as their full name, date of birth, date of passing, and any other significant details you want to include in the program. You may also want to gather photos that you can use in the program to create a visual tribute.

2. Choose a Template

Next, select a funeral program template that reflects the personality and style of the deceased. There are many online resources where you can find customizable templates for funeral programs. Choose a design that resonates with you and the family.

3. Compile the Program

Using the information and photos you gathered, start compiling the funeral program. Include details such as the order of service, a brief obituary, favorite poems or quotes, and any special acknowledgments. Make sure to proofread the content for accuracy and coherence.

4. Select Readings and Verses

Consider adding meaningful readings, verses, or religious scriptures to the funeral program. These can offer solace and comfort to those in attendance and serve as a tribute to the life of the deceased.

5. Personalize the Design

Make the funeral program unique by personalizing the design elements. Add the deceased’s favorite colors, symbols, or motifs to create a program that truly reflects their life and personality.

6. Print and Distribute

Once you are satisfied with the final design, print the funeral programs on quality paper. Make enough copies to distribute to all attendees at the service. Consider adding a thank you message or a note of remembrance on the back page.

7. Include Contact Information

Don’t forget to include contact information for the family or organizing committee in the funeral program. This can help guests reach out for support or assistance after the service.

Choosing the Right Template Size for Funeral Program Printing – Helpful Guide & Resources

When it comes to creating a meaningful and personalized funeral program for a loved one, choosing the right template size is an important decision. The size of the funeral program can have a significant impact on how the information is presented and how it is received by those attending the service. Understanding the various options available and considering factors such as content, design, and practicality can help you make the best choice for your needs.

Why Template Size Matters

The size of the funeral program template plays a crucial role in determining the overall look and feel of the final product. A larger template size may allow for more content and images to be included, making it ideal for those who want to provide detailed information about the deceased or include multiple photos. On the other hand, a smaller template size can be more compact and easier to handle, especially for attendees who may want to keep the program as a keepsake.

Considerations for Choosing the Right Size

1. Content and Information

Before selecting a template size, consider the amount of content and information you wish to include in the funeral program. If you have a lot of details to share, such as a lengthy obituary or a timeline of the deceased’s life, a larger template size may be more suitable. Conversely, if you prefer a more concise and streamlined approach, a smaller template size may be a better fit.

2. Design and Layout

The size of the template can also influence the design and layout of the funeral program. Larger templates offer more space for creative design elements, such as borders, backgrounds, and decorative fonts. Smaller templates, on the other hand, may require a simpler and more minimalist design to ensure that all essential information remains legible and organized.

Step-by-Step Guide to Creating a Funeral Program – Helpful Guide & Resources

Planning a funeral can be an emotional and overwhelming experience. One important element of the funeral process is creating a funeral program. A funeral program is a meaningful keepsake for loved ones, providing details about the deceased and the schedule of the funeral service. In this step-by-step guide, we will walk you through the process of creating a thoughtful and personalized funeral program to honor your loved one’s memory.

1. Gather Information

Start by collecting essential information that you want to include in the funeral program. This may consist of the full name of the deceased, birth and death dates, a brief obituary or biography, the order of service, and any special messages or quotes.

2. Choose a Template

Select a funeral program template that reflects the personality and style of the deceased. There are plenty of customizable templates available online, or you can create your own design. Make sure the template is easy to read and carries a respectful tone.

3. Personalize the Program

Customize the template with the gathered information. Add the deceased’s photo, choose fonts that are clear and readable, and include any meaningful images or graphics. Personalizing the program will make it a cherished memento for attendees.

4. Proofread and Review

Take the time to proofread the content and review the layout of the funeral program. Ensure that all information is accurate and free of errors. It may be helpful to have a family member or friend review the program as well.

5. Print and Distribute

Once you are satisfied with the final design, print the funeral programs on high-quality paper. Consider the number of attendees and print an appropriate quantity. Distribute the programs to family members, friends, and guests before the service begins.

6. Include Personal Touches

Consider adding personal touches to the funeral program, such as favorite poems, song lyrics, or memories shared by family members. These elements can make the program more intimate and special for those attending the service.
